District assigns assistant superintendents to cover special-ed duties; board cites $50,000 short-term savings

The board approved temporary additional duties and pay for two assistant superintendents to cover the retiring special-education director from March 1 through June 30 at $160 per day, a move the administration said will save about $50,000 over that period.

Public comment included a question about personnel item #14: the temporary assignment of additional responsibilities to two central-administration staff (Miss DeMeo and Mr. Thomas) from March 1 through June 30 at a rate of $160 per day. A resident asked, "What additional responsibilities?" and noted the pay rate and potential equity concerns.

The administration replied that the special-education director is retiring March 1 and the district opted not to rehire immediately; instead the two assistants will perform director duties in addition to their own work. A district speaker said this approach is expected to save the district about $50,000 between March 1 and June 30. The board later approved the personnel agenda that included these assignments.
